Upstream-Status: Inappropriate [SDK specific] This patch puts the dynamic loader path in the binaries, SYSTEM_DIRS strings and lengths as well as ld.so.cache path in the dynamic loader to specific sections in memory. The sections that contain paths have been allocated a 4096 byte section, which is the maximum path length in linux. This will allow the relocating script to parse the ELF binary, detect the section and easily replace the strings in a certain path.
